Product reviews:
Norton
2025-03-15 iphone Xs
ELC EARLY LEARNING Centre Tower Of Doom elc tower of doom wooden castle
elc tower of doom wooden castle
Ronald
2025-03-13 iphone XS Max
wooden castle and Trebuchet,Siege Tower elc tower of doom wooden castle
elc tower of doom wooden castle
Ted
2025-03-12 iphone 7 Plus
Early Learning Centre Tower of Doom in elc tower of doom wooden castle
elc tower of doom wooden castle
Marsh
2025-03-17 iphone SE
Play Castle by Early Learning Centre elc tower of doom wooden castle
elc tower of doom wooden castle